Homemade Citrus Loaf Recipe

One of the most common recipes with bread involves adding a dash of citrus. This citrus loaf recipe is really more of a dessert, due to the sugar, and the citrus flavor is interchangeable, so this loaf can have lots of different flavors.

Here are the ingredients that you will need to make the citrus loaf:

  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 1 cup (8 ounces) sour cream or Greek yogurt
  • 4 lemons, zested (this could also be limes, grapefruit, oranges or any citrus!)
    • OR  1 tablespoon lemon extract
  •  1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 1/2 cups fl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

First, you need to pre-heat the o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it. Then, in a large bowl, whisk all of the eggs, sugar, and yogurt together until everything is combined.

Then, whisk in oil, zest or extract until the mixture is fully combined. Next, you can whisk in all of the flour, baking powder and salt. It’s a good idea to whisk everything together by hand as to not overmix the batter.

Pour it into a 9×13 bread pan. Finally, you need to bake the pan at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for 55-60 minutes. Check the mixture with the toothpick, and if it comes out clean, then the loaf is done.

Next, you need to make the sugar soak for the loaf. Here are the ingredients:

  • 1 cup confectioners’ sugar
  • 6 tablespoons lemon juice

While the loaf is baking, you should make the soak. First, whisk together the powdered sugar and lemon juice until smooth. Once the loaf is done, pour the soak on the loaf while it’s cooling so it sops up all the flavor and moisture.

Finally, here are the ingredients that you need to make the glaze:

  • 1 cup confectioners’ sugar
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ice

First, whisk together the sugar and lemon juice until it’s smooth. Once the cake has cooled completely (which takes about 2 hours) pour the glaze atop the cake, so it creates a nice sugary layer. Now, the loaf can be sliced and served.
